ALEXANDRIA, Va., Sept. 10 -- United States Patent no. 12,411,616, issued on Sept. 9, was assigned to EMC IP Holding Co. LLC (Hopkinton, Mass.).

"Storage system and method using persistent memory" was invented by Oran Baruch (Tel Aviv, Israel), Ronen Gazit (Tel Aviv, Israel) and Jenny Derzhavetz (Ra'anana, Israel).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A method, computer program product, and computing system for sensing a failure within a system within a computing device. The system may include a cache memory system and a vaulted memory comprising a random access memory (RAM) having a plurality of independent persistent areas.
